TIM Brasil has teamed up with Chinese vendor Huawei to test 5G voice-over-New Radio (VoNR) services using the 3.5GHz band. TeleSintese quotes Marco Di Costanzo, Network Director at TIM Brasil, as saying: ‘We want to offer a complete, end-to-end experience, with the best and most advanced 5G network in the country.’

In November 2021 TIM Brasil successfully bid on 5G-suitable spectrum in the 2.3GHz, 3.5GHz and 26GHz bands. TIM paid BRL1.05 billion (USD190 million) for eleven lots of spectrum and is obliged to offer 5G services in all state capitals and the Federal District (Distrito Federal) by 31 July 2022.
